The Library of American Broadcasting Foundation will present its third annual Insight Award to Emmy Award-winning broadcaster, author, and philanthropist Soledad O’Brien during the NAB Show Welcome on April 15. The Insight Award recognizes an individual or organization for an outstanding artistic or journalistic work or body of work that enhances the public’s understanding of the role, operation, history or impact of media in our society. Previous recipients include LeVar Burton and “60 Minutes.”

Chicago Sports Talk Enters Syndication

STC Media, LLC announces that its flagship program, “Sports Talk Chicago,” begins syndication across radio and TV stations in Illinois and Indiana. The program, which boasts 18,500 YouTube subscribers and a dedicated podcast following, is now airing on six media outlets including WRPW-FM, Bloomington and WKAN, Kankakee, Illinois.
